What is Inner Mongolia's Energy Development Plan?

In response to the need for a shift in energy production and consumption, Inner Mongolia has published its Fourteenth Five-Year Energy Development Plan (2021–2025), which specifically aims to further the progress of energy development through green, digital, and innovative transformation.

How much solar power does Inner Mongolia have?

Foresight Industry Research Institute Inner Mongolia experiences yearly sunlight hours ranging from 2600 to 3,400, and its total solar radiation is the second highest in China. In 2023, the region's installed solar power generation capacity reached 23.06 million kilowatts, reflecting a 47.12 % growth from 2022.
